Natural Resources All About Zambia!

Zambia has ten natural resources. they are: copper cobalt zinc lead uranium coal emeralds gold silver hydro-power Zambia holds 6% of the worlds copper reserves and is the 4th largest copper producing nation.

Zambia BIOFIN

2022年10月4日Zambia has Eight Wetlands of International Importance which include, the Kafue Flats (Lochnivar and Blue Lagoon National Parks) Bangweulu Swamps (Chikuni), Lukanga Swamps, Busanga, Lake Tanganyika,, Luangwa Floodplains, Lukanga swamps, Barotse floodplain) listed under the Ramsar Convention.

Zambia Wildlife Sector Policy : Situation Analysis and

Zambia is endowed with an abundance of natural resources that include, water, forests and wildlife. The country's wildlife resources are managed through government-supported National Parks and Game Management Areas (GMAs) and private sector game ranches. Ministry of Lands and Natural Resources (Zambia)

The Ministry of Lands and Natural Resources was re-aligned in 2016 through Government Gazette Number 836 of 2016. This re-alignment saw the removal of the function of environmental protection from the Ministry.
